Circle G and X connect at point Y. The length of G Y is 10 centimeters and the length of Y X is 16 centimeters.
Point G is the center of the small circle. Point X is the center of the large circle. Points G, Y, and X are all on line segment GX.
Marco wants to create a new circle using GX as a radius. What will be the area of Marco’s new circle?
10Pi centimeters squared
16Pi centimeters squared
356Pi centimeters squared
676Pi centimeters squared

Because G, Y, and X are collinear and Y is the tangency point, GX = GY + YX = 10 + 16 = 26 cm.
Area = π·(26)^2 = 676π cm².
Answer: 676Pi centimeters squared.
